  14. Not really true, ED has sales and also usually discounts modules when they are first announced for beta release. Also can catch sales at Gamefly etc... Not sure what value to the sim that adds buy maybe I don't understand. You can still add DCS World to Steam manually and use the overlay. In the past speed made a difference, but that does not seem to be a problem anymore. Actually you get updates available through the standalone sooner. One big thing for me is quick access to the modules, with Steam, you are going to be waiting 2-3 weeks for a module to be available after it has been released on the standalone. Almost every other game/sim I have is on Steam, and it has it's great points, but for DCS I saw no benefit and only drawbacks to having it there. :beer:

  17. The control setups are stored there and you copied them so that is good, after you copy them you need to load each column under each aircraft individually. It won't read them correctly to start because they are stored by controller id in the file name, so if the controller has a different name, they won't load automatically. Go into each aircraft and click in the column you want to load, and in the upper right there is a load profile button. That will pull up a window where you can select the .diff.lua you want to load. Make sure you select the one that was copied from your old controller. Also make sure you are in the right subdirectory for the aircraft you are setting the controls on. The pic shows loading the controls for the UH-1 and notice the directory is /input/UH-1H/Joystick.

  21. If I understand you correctly you have a setup similar to mine, 1 PC with OS and multiple user accounts on it (all for me but different purposes like work, gaming, general, etc..) DCS will only activate under the account it was installed under as the license keys are stored under HKEY_CURRENT_USER\Software\Eagle Dynamics in the registry. If you want to run it under a different account on the same PC, export the above registry key while logged into the account that it was installed under, and then import it while logged into the account you want to have access to it.
